From 31 May to 31 August 2023
Massimo Kaufmann's “The rules of the game” opens on May 31 at the Museo del Novecento in Milan, an exhibition with a strong interactive and performative character that animates FORUM900.
On display until 31 August are four works, veritable artist's chessboards : three of these, made of wood and with regulatory measurements (57x57cm), consist of the usual 64 houses and 32 chessmen painted with oil colors in 96 different colors, the fourth, Pan, smaller in size, is intended for children.
Despite the clear subversion of the first rule of chess - which here no longer provides only for black and white to oppose each other but for an infinite possibility of colors - the methods and rules of the game remain identical and the boards are perfectly usable: two fairly expert players can confront each other according to all the canonical rules without incurring any other inconvenience other than the perceptive confusion generated by the colors and accentuated by the continuous movement of the pieces.
As proof of this, the four chessboards are made available to visitors who, upon reservation, will be able to compete in exciting chess duels on Tuesday during the lunch break - from 12.30 to 14.30 - and on Thursday before the scheduled talks. Even the artist will be open to challenges: a presence that transforms the exhibition project into a performance .
